I have voted for Ralph Nader repeatedly, not because I was voting “against” — but because I was voting “for.” Never taking the luxury of sitting out an election, I always vote my own hope and, in the act of voting my hope, I create hope.
·
I vote my
hope for an inclusive democracy of many and varied voices, a democracy in
which all voices are heard, not just voices and ideas mass media and entrenched
power permit to air their voices and
ideas.
·
I vote my
hope for good governance, courageous leadership that is, in the words of former
presidential candidate and U.S. Congresswoman Shirley Chisholm — “unbought and unbossed.”
·
I vote my
hope for officials who are incorruptible.
·
I vote my
hope for a new breed of honesty that keeps faith with the people, instead
of pandering to moneyed interests, and keeps the oath to uphold the
Constitution of the United States of America.
·
I vote my
hope for officials who are nonviolent in domestic and foreign policy and practice.
·
I vote my
hope for officials who retain a sensibility for and are constructively responsive
to the needs of all humanity, the environment, the world.
When I voted
for Ralph Nader, I was voting my own hope.
Ralph Nader is not running for the U.S. presidency this year but he has
endorsed Rocky Anderson.
